Transaction 085820cde260bd68bd94afddb14840d29b0b34c2bac1b575adad71ad8a84bf06

1 Input
2 Outputs
  • 085820cde260bd68bd94afddb14840d29b0b34c2bac1b575adad71ad8a84bf06:0
  • value  100000000
    address  17FmFmRYZLNnQD1CET65WSPTwYNFt8SEsg
  • 085820cde260bd68bd94afddb14840d29b0b34c2bac1b575adad71ad8a84bf06:1
  • value  3438214529
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x